There are some tests being carried out on the 70cm repeater with the aim of
getting Echolink to co-exist with IRLP.
This will be a test until the end of September 07, after which time it's
continuance will be evaluated. If something goes wrong during the test , it
will be turned off or modified.
The method being used is to do an on-air link via a cross band repeater to
node 258361, which is VK2HSL-L
This is on 145.350 simplex and is located in Manly. There is an excellent
path between Bondi & Manly that makes this possible.
There will be an hourly announcement that advises of the link and some other
information.
We believe that if both IRLP and Echolink are active, there will be a two
way flow of signals.
IRLP nodes are listed here: http://status.irlp.net/statuspage.html
Echolink nodes are listed here: http://www.echolink.org/logins.jsp
To use Echolink prefix the node with a #
To sign off from both systems is the normal 73
We have noticed that the Echolink end at present is not decoding the DTMF
signals properly when being keyed via the 70cm repeater, so that sometimes
it's hard to dial up an Echolink node.
Echolink does work if started on the 145.350 simplex frequency.
